Step 1
Preheat a large frying pan or griddle to medium heat.
Step 2
If your potatoes are cold from the fridge, I recommend warming them up slightly and giving them a second mash or beating with an electric mixer so they're easier to work with.
Step 3
In a large bowl add the mashed potatoes, eggs, flour, cheese, parsley, salt and pepper.
Step 4
Stir the ingredients together.
Step 5
Grease the frying pan/skillet lightly.
Step 6
Form the dough into patties about 1/4 cup of batter each. Flatten the patty between your palms.
Step 7
Fry on the one side until golden (about 3-5 minutes), then flip and fry on the second side until golden.
